3. Bài mẫu hoàn chỉnh

As digital technology continues to develop, many people now access information online instead of visiting traditional libraries. While some argue that governments should stop funding free public libraries because information is easily available on the internet, I believe libraries still play an essential role in education and society.

One important advantage of public libraries is the provision of equal access to knowledge. Not everyone can afford personal computers, expensive textbooks, or stable internet connections, particularly people from low-income backgrounds. Public libraries provide free access to books, computers, and educational materials, ensuring educational resource availability for all citizens. In addition, libraries serve as valuable community learning spaces, where students and researchers can study in quiet study environments without distractions. Libraries also support promotion of reading habits, especially among children, by encouraging regular reading and independent learning. Furthermore, they provide significant cultural and social value through public events, educational workshops, and community programs. For these reasons, libraries continue to offer benefits that online resources alone cannot fully replace.

On the other hand, supporters of digital learning argue that the internet offers easy online information access and greater convenience. Today, people can access academic articles, e-books, and educational videos within seconds through smartphones or computers. In addition, digital learning convenience allows individuals to study anytime and anywhere, making traditional libraries less necessary for some users. Governments may also face government spending concerns because maintaining libraries often involves high maintenance costs, including staff salaries, building upkeep, and technology investment. Moreover, technological advancement impact has contributed to declining library usage in certain areas.

Overall, although the internet has transformed the way people access information, I believe free public libraries should continue to be funded because they promote educational equality and provide valuable community services.

Sentence Structures

1. While some argue that + clause, I believe + clause because + clause (dùng để mở bài với quan điểm cá nhân rõ ràng)

E.g. While some argue that governments should stop funding free public libraries because information is easily available on the internet, I believe libraries still play an essential role in education and society.

2. One important advantage of + noun phrase + is the provision of + noun phrase (dùng để mở đoạn nêu lợi ích)

E.g. One important advantage of public libraries is the provision of equal access to knowledge.

3. In addition, + subject + serve(s) as + noun phrase, where + clause (dùng để giải thích chức năng của địa điểm hoặc tổ chức)

E.g. In addition, libraries serve as valuable community learning spaces, where students and researchers can study in quiet study environments without distractions.

4. On the other hand, supporters of + noun phrase + argue that + clause (dùng để chuyển sang quan điểm đối lập)

E.g. On the other hand, supporters of digital learning argue that the internet offers easy online information access and greater convenience.

5. Governments may also face + noun phrase + because + clause (dùng để phân tích vấn đề tài chính hoặc xã hội)

E.g. Governments may also face government spending concerns because maintaining libraries often involves high maintenance costs.

6. Overall, although + clause, I believe + clause because + clause (dùng để kết luận với lập trường nhất quán)

E.g. Overall, although the internet has transformed the way people access information, I believe free public libraries should continue to be funded because they promote educational equality and provide valuable community services.
